This week saw the annual trip to Leeuwarden for the Fresian Flag exercise. This year’s participants were the USAF with 12 F15s from the Massachusetts and Oregon National Guards; 8 German Eurofighters; 7 Spanish F18s; 3 Polish Mig 29s and 5 F16s; 4 French Mirage 2000Ds and 9 Rafales; plus Dutch F16s from Volkel & Leeuwarden itself, 17 of which were noted on the 2 days we were there (but still short of my last one). 2 mass launches take place each day with around 50 jets in each wave. The good people of Aviation Group Leeuwarden as usual arranged car parking in the field near the mound for the very reasonable sum of 3 Euro per day. EasyJet from Luton to Schipol and an hour and a bit in the rental car up to the base, with time allowed for some viewing at Schipol itself. Just a few of the shots below to give a flavour.
